The annual meeting of Wal-Mart Stores Inc. turned into a memorial Friday with 10,000 people gathering to honor founder Sam Walton two months after his death. The Barnhill Arena at the University of Arkansas was filled to capacity, with the overflow crowd moving to a room equipped with closed-circuit television.

The program began and ended with the song, "A Moment in Time." Three huge TV screens displayed past meetings with Walton talking to shareholders and employees.
